Technical Product Manager (TPM)

The Company

Strata is a venture-backed startup building the next generation of distributed identity management for the multi-cloud world. Led by a visionary team of serial entrepreneurs (with multiple exits) who built the first generation of Web identity management, the first IDaaS solution, co-authored SAML, and now are creating the Identity Orchestration market.

This is truly a ground-floor opportunity for a Technical Product Manager that wants to have a hand in building the future of multi-cloud identity. Imagine if you were on the original team that built Kubernetes? Strata is that opportunity applied to the hottest, exponentially growing security market.

The Team

At Strata, we build software using the Pivotal Labs Agile model leveraging small stories, and test-driven development in a highly collaborative (and fun) environment. Our engineering team is a hybrid model with a development team in Vancouver paired with engineers across the US. We build Maverics using GoLang and we practice build/run with DevSecOps.

The Product

Strata’s platform—Maverics—is an abstraction layer that makes delivering identity to apps simple, all without requiring any rewriting of applications. By creating an Identity Fabric, customers can seamlessly integrate with multiple identity infrastructures enabling next-level agility and cloud-scale.

At Strata, we work closely with our partners at Microsoft Azure, Okta, AWS, GCP, and VMware to ensure interoperability through deep, native integrations. Strata’s Maverics Identity Orchestration software runs natively in the cloud or on-premises either as a native service or containerized on Kubernetes.

We build our software to be secure, scalable, and extensible.

Secure. We take security seriously and build it into the core of what we develop and how we run our platform. In this role, you will help ensure that our software and processes are hyper-secure to be trusted by the biggest brands and companies in the world.

Scalable. Strata’s customers rely on our software to secure their core business operations, meaning we need to be available 99.999%. In this role, you will architect and implement proven resiliency patterns to ensure rock-solid reliability.

Extensibility. Strata is building a platform for distributed identity management with plans to support evolving use cases that our customers bring us weekly. As such, we build our software to easily integrate with and manage many other identity infrastructure systems. In this role, you will help make Maverics the one platform to rule them all (or at least manage them all).

The Role


The Technical Product Manager (TPM) is the engine that runs our agile development process. Day to day you live in the backlog, working with the product owner to create the product backlog, writing very small stories (we think of these as placeholders for further in-depth conversations with developers), breaking down those stories with developers, working with developers on technical design and implementation, and doing story acceptance. 

On a weekly basis, the TPM runs our agile ceremonies including Agile Pod scoping, project inceptions, iteration planning meetings, daily standups, iteration reviews, and retrospectives. 

The TPM defines and collects metrics that help us track quality, velocity, product/feature adoption, and usability.

The TPM represents the voice of the customer to Pod members, defines and owns the detailed product roadmap, defines the product’s technical strategy at the use case level, owns the feature backlog and prioritization, and represents the technical details of the product to stakeholders. 

The TPM works with customers to understand and gather detailed technical requirements, works closely with the Customer Success team to support customers, drives product adoption, and works to make sure every customer recommends Strata as a great partner with a phenomenal product (nothing like an amazing net promoter score!)


Strata is a culture-driven company based on our core values: honesty, openness, transparency, integrity, accountability, and empowerment. We live these values every day and want to work with people who believe strongly in these core values.

People with the following traits will find ready success within Strata.

  • Autonomous and assertive and can apply those traits in a highly collaborative environment
  • Accountable – dislikes hearing “that’s not my job” as much as we do
  • Curious about the market, how emerging trends drive customer needs, and able to synthesize learnings into innovative products and features 
  • Willing to experiment, get things wrong but learn quickly and move on
  • Passionate about customer success
  • Articulate and able to make complex concepts easy to understand
  • Takes joy in the success of colleagues and teammates and free with expressions of gratitude
  • Acts with compassion and empathy and is always ready to help out or support a fellow Maveric


  • 7-10 years of hands-on technical product management experience with enterprise products and services.
  • A degree in computer science or related work experience.
  • Has experience with and is comfortable working in a highly distributed, remote team.
  • Hands-on experience with Pivotal Tracker, Github, and DevOps toolsets.
  • Experience with GoLang and Javascript.

The ideal candidate has deep expertise in the following areas.

  1. Deep domain knowledge in modern identity and access management with hands-on experience using modern identity protocols and standards such as OIDC, SAML, SCIM, and products such as Okta, Azure AD/B2C, Auth0.
  2. Extensive experience with legacy protocols/products such as LDAP and Active Directory and deep knowledge of proprietary web access management (WAM) and identity governance & administration (IGA) technologies such as CA Siteminder, Oracle Access Manager, Ping Identity, Forgerock, ADFS, and Sailpoint.
  3. Extensive, day-to-day, hands-on experience running an agile development model (ours is patterned on Pivotal Labs). Have a strong understanding of how to adapt agile processes and tools to the unique needs of each Pod.
  4. Experience with cloud identity platforms, cloud native applications, and Saas and an understanding of how large enterprise customers use these platforms, integrate their apps with those identity systems and manage this in hybrid environments.
  5. Enterprise architectures and deployment patterns including HTTP, networking, web applications. Experience working within the complex environments typical of Fortune 500 IT teams.
  6. Experience with cloud platforms (AWS, Azure, GCP, VMWare), their identity systems (Azure AD, AWS IAM),  tools (Terraform, Puppet, Chef), and modern platforms (Kubernetes, Docker, Istio, SPIFFE/SPIRE). Deep knowledge of how distributed systems are built, deployed, run, and managed.
  7. Have specific experience making customers successful through the entire lifecycle including presales, post-sales deployments, product adoption/expansion, and renewal. 

Email your resume and/or your Linkedin profile to [email protected]

At Strata, we’re looking for people with passion, grit, and integrity. You’re encouraged to apply even if your experience doesn’t precisely match the job description. Join us.